88088000027 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 88088000028. Its totient is φ = 88088000026.
The previous prime is 88087999981. The next prime is 88088000029. The reversal of 88088000027 is 72000088088.
It is a strong pr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 88088000027 - 28 = 88087999771 is a prime.
Together with 88088000029, it forms a pair of twin primes.
It is a Chen pr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(88088000029)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 44044000013 + 44044000014.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(44044000014).
Almost surely, 288088000027 is an apocalyptic number.
88088000027 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
88088000027 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
88088000027 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 57344, while the sum is 41.
The spelling of 88088000027 in words is "eighty-eight billion, eighty-eight million, twenty-seven", and thus it is an aban number and an uban number.
